Transaction 6883f96024966edf19f8ade070ad2ad126bfa0338058872a95e59a538aa3dcfa

1 Input
2 Outputs
  • 6883f96024966edf19f8ade070ad2ad126bfa0338058872a95e59a538aa3dcfa:0
  • value  10263914
    address  1PQbAy3Hz8pvBrUe7bH7uujjext9hvJ7mV
  • 6883f96024966edf19f8ade070ad2ad126bfa0338058872a95e59a538aa3dcfa:1
  • value  121614
    address  3PVhMy4S4zoHmxEeYjrzZ3wHEDdoaS3gLX